Summary
The latest "HardTech Reads" highlights significant advancements and commercial milestones in AI and robotics. Agility Robotics is set to become the first pure-play humanoid public company via a \$2.5 billion SPAC merger, while Unitree received approval for its Shanghai IPO, signaling growing public market interest. China's humanoid sector saw substantial funding, with AI² Robotics raising approximately \$735 million and X Square Robot surpassing a \$2.8 billion valuation. Key technological developments include 1X unveiling NEO's 25-degree-of-freedom tendon-driven hands and Sanctuary AI achieving 99.5%+ task success in wire-plugging. Companies like Apptronik are establishing large data factories, such as the 90,000 sq ft Robot Park, to accelerate humanoid training. Additionally, Mistral AI released its first robotics model, Robostral Navigate, and Pudu Robotics announced plans for the world's first fully robot-operated hotel by 2027, underscoring the rapid commercialization and expanding applications of advanced robotics.
